Overview
- Police confirmed late Sunday that the six- and nine-year-old from Bad Sassendorf had been found unharmed.
- The pair, identified as Mimoza M. and Louis B., were last seen around 10 a.m. on the grounds of the Kinderfachklinik and live in a residential group.
- Officers issued a public call for help with names and clothing details and asked people to report sightings to the 110 emergency number.
- Authorities noted both children often use public transport, so the appeal focused on buses and trains that residents might use.
